The LONGi Hi‑MO 7 LR8‑66HGD 625W bifacial solar module is engineered for high‑performance utility, commercial, and industrial solar installations. Built with advanced HPDC cell technology and a dual‑glass structure, this module delivers exceptional power density, enhanced bifacial energy gain, and long‑term lifecycle reliability.

Designed for demanding environments and large‑scale deployments, the 625W Hi‑MO 7 offers high efficiency of 23.1%, strong temperature coefficients, and certified durability for maximum long‑term output.


Key Features

High Power Output

  • Maximum power output: 625W
  • Module efficiency: 23.1%
  • Power tolerance: 0 to +3%

Bifacial Energy Gain

  • Bifaciality factor: 80 ± 5%
  • Rear‑side energy gain increases total yield by 5–25% depending on installation conditions.

Durable Dual‑Glass Construction

  • Dual heat‑strengthened glass (2.0 mm + 2.0 mm)
  • Mechanical load resistance:
    • Front: 5400 Pa
    • Rear: 2400 Pa
  • Hail impact tested with 25 mm hailstones at 23 m/s

Long‑Term Reliability

  • 12‑year product warranty
  • 30‑year linear power warranty
  • First‑year degradation: less than 1%
  • Annual degradation from Year 2–30: 0.4%

Superior Temperature Performance

  • Temperature coefficient of Pmax: ‑0.28%/°C
  • Lower operating temperatures due to half‑cell architecture

Technical Specifications

Electrical Characteristics (STC)

  • Maximum Power (Pmax): 625W
  • Open‑Circuit Voltage (Voc): 48.98V
  • Short‑Circuit Current (Isc): 16.10A
  • Voltage at Max Power (Vmp): 41.11V
  • Current at Max Power (Imp): 15.21A

NOCT Performance

  • Pmax: 475.8W
  • Voc: 46.55V
  • Isc: 12.93A
  • Vmp: 39.07V
  • Imp: 12.18A

Mechanical Specifications

  • Dimensions: 2382 × 1134 × 30 mm
  • Weight: 33.5 kg
  • Frame: Anodized aluminium alloy
  • Junction box: IP68 with three diodes
  • Cable: 4 mm², ±1400 mm (customizable)

Operating Conditions

  • Operating temperature: −40°C to +85°C
  • Maximum system voltage: 1500V DC
  • Maximum series fuse rating: 35A
  • Protection class: Class II

Certifications

  • IEC 61215
  • IEC 61730
  • UL 61730
  • ISO 9001:2015
  • ISO 14001:2015
  • ISO 45001:2018
  • IEC 62941

Ideal Applications

  • Utility‑scale solar farms
  • Commercial rooftops
  • Industrial facilities
  • Ground‑mount bifacial systems
  • High‑albedo environments for maximum rear‑side gain
